Louisiana Bar Foundation Honors Professor William Corbett and LSU Law Alum Frank Neuner, Jr. (’76)

The Louisiana Bar Foundation honored Professor William Corbett as Distinguished Professor and Frank Neuner, Jr. (’76) as Distinguished Attorney at the 28th Annual Fellows Gala on April 11, 2014. The gala was held at the Hyatt Regency New Orleans.

Recognition is given to those individuals who, by reason of his or her professional activities, have distinguished themselves in their chosen profession and have brought credit and honor to the legal profession.

Professor William Corbett is the Frank L. Maraist and Wex S. Malone Professor of Law at the LSU Law Center. He has been a faculty member at LSU Law since 1991, and teaches and writes primarily in the areas of labor and employment law and torts. Professor Corbett served as Vice Chancellor for Academic Affairs at the Law Center from 1997 through 1999. He has served as the executive director of the Louisiana Association of Defense Counsel since 2001 and served as executive director of the Louisiana Judicial College from 1998 through 2000. Professor Corbett earned his B.A. from Auburn University and his law degree from the University of Alabama School of Law, where he was editor in chief of the Alabama Law Review and a member of the Order of the Coif. Before coming to the LSU Law Center, he practiced labor and employment law in Birmingham, Alabama with Burr & Forman.

Frank Neuner, Jr. is a founder and the managing partner of NeunerPate, a corporate defense firm based in Lafayette. He received a Juris Doctor in 1976 from LSU Law and in 2008, was named the LSU Law Center’s Distinguished Alumnus of the Year. He has served as President of the Louisiana State Bar Association, Chair of the Louisiana Public Defender Board and President of the Louisiana Client Assistance Foundation. He is a member of Louisiana, Texas and American Bar Associations, the Louisiana Association of Defense Counsel, the Defense Research Institute, the Maritime Law Association of the United States and the Federation of Defense and Corporate Counsel. He is also a Fellow of the International Society of Barristers and serves as the ABA State Delegate for Louisiana. Mr. Neuner is a long-time member of the LSU Law Center’s Chancellor’s Council and the Law Center’s Board of Trustees.
